Q: Is 361,746 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 361,746 is a composite number.

Why is 361,746 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 361,746 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 9 11 14 18 21 22 27 29 33 42 54 58 63 66 77 81 87 99 126 154 162 174 189 198 203 231 261 297 319 378 406 462 522 567 594 609 638 693 783 891 957 1,134 1,218 1,386 1,566 1,782 1,827 1,914 2,079 2,233 2,349 2,871 3,654 4,158 4,466 4,698 5,481 5,742 6,237 6,699 8,613 10,962 12,474 13,398 16,443 17,226 20,097 25,839 32,886 40,194 51,678 60,291 120,582 180,873 and 361,746, with no remainder.

Since 361,746 cannot be divided by just 1 and 361,746, it is a composite number.
